A haunting halo

Some kind of chemistry voodoo must be at work. Funnily enough, the chemical reaction that takes city mimics one of the most famous examples of paranormal activity: the séance.

Fluorophores are the molecules that emanate the fluorescent light. Though different fluorophores have different chemical structures, they all have one obsession in common: rings upon rings of interlocked carbon atoms. Contrive of these carbon rings as people who want to communicate with the dead. Each man holds hands with his or her neighbor, forming a continuous circle. In appendage to this physical connection, there’s an intangible aura shared evenly between everyone. On the atomic spectrum, this mystical energy is actually a diffuse cloud of electrons distributed equally among the carbon atoms. Without it, the fluorophore won’t exude light.

Trapped in the glow stick is a glass capsule containing hydrogen peroxide. Like a worked up spirit, it has boundless energy to unleash. Bending the glow persist cracks open the capsule, unleashing the volatile liquid into the fluorophore revelation. It doesn’t interact with the fluorophore directly, though, just as the spirits only friend the séance members through a medium. Instead, it reacts with diphenyl oxalate, a molecular middleman predisposed to of interacting with the hydrogen peroxide.
